Show Notes

In this episode, I’m speaking to Sufian Sadiq about being a Muslim in Britain, his experience of Islamophobia, and his reaction to the current situation in the Middle East and how it is being handled in British society.

Sufian Sadiq is Director of Talent and Teaching School at Chiltern Learning Trust.
